fre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計(jì)論文-基于51單片機(jī)的電子時(shí)鐘的設(shè)計(jì)與制作(編輯修改稿)

2025-02-13 01:36 本頁面
 

【文章內(nèi)容簡介】 89S51 共有 4096 個(gè) 8 位掩膜 ROM,用于存放用戶程序、原始數(shù)據(jù)或表格。 2. 定時(shí) /計(jì)數(shù)器( ROM): 89S51 有兩個(gè) 16 位的可編程定時(shí)、計(jì)算器,以實(shí)現(xiàn)定時(shí)或計(jì)數(shù)產(chǎn)生中斷用于控制程序轉(zhuǎn)向。 3. 并行輸入輸出( I/O)口: 89S51 時(shí)鐘 程 序 存 儲(chǔ)器 數(shù) 據(jù) 存 儲(chǔ)器 定時(shí)計(jì)數(shù)器 并行 I/O 口 串 行 通 信口 中斷系統(tǒng) 電 子 時(shí) 鐘 的 設(shè) 計(jì) 與 制 作 4 89S51 共有 8 位 I/O 口( p0、 p p p3),用于對(duì)外部數(shù)據(jù)的傳輸。 4. 全雙工串行口: 89S51 內(nèi)置一個(gè)全雙工串行通信口,用于與其它設(shè)備間的串行數(shù)據(jù)傳送,該串行口既可以用作異步通信收發(fā)器,也可以當(dāng)同步移位器使用。 5. 中斷系統(tǒng): 8051 具 備較完善的中斷功能,有兩個(gè)外中斷、兩個(gè)定時(shí) /計(jì)數(shù)器和一個(gè)串行中斷,可滿足不同的控制要求,并具有 2 個(gè)級(jí)的優(yōu)先級(jí)別的選擇。 6. 時(shí)鐘電路: 8051 內(nèi)置最高頻率達(dá) 12MHZ 的時(shí)鐘電路,用于產(chǎn)生整個(gè)單片機(jī)運(yùn)行的脈沖時(shí)序,但 8951 單片機(jī)需外置振蕩電容。 單片機(jī)的結(jié)構(gòu)有兩種類型,一種是程序存儲(chǔ)器和數(shù)據(jù)存儲(chǔ)器分開的形式,即哈弗( Harvard)結(jié)構(gòu),另一種是采用通用計(jì)算機(jī)廣泛使用的程序存儲(chǔ)器與數(shù)據(jù)存儲(chǔ)器合二為一的結(jié)構(gòu),即普林斯頓( Princeton)結(jié)構(gòu)。 INTEL 的 AT89S51 系列單片機(jī)采用的是哈弗結(jié)構(gòu)的形式,而后 續(xù)產(chǎn)品 16 位的 MCS96 系列單片機(jī)則采用普林斯頓結(jié)構(gòu)。 89S51 的引腳說明: AT89S51 系列單片機(jī)中的 8951 采用 40Pin 封裝的雙列直接 DIP 結(jié)構(gòu), 下 圖是他們的引腳配置, 40 個(gè)引腳,正電源個(gè)地線兩根,外置適應(yīng)振蕩器的時(shí)鐘線兩根, 4組 8 位 32 個(gè) I/O 口,中斷口線與 p3 口線復(fù)用?,F(xiàn)在我們對(duì)這些引腳的功能加以說明: 電 子 時(shí) 鐘 的 設(shè) 計(jì) 與 制 作 5 圖二 . Pin9: RESET/Vpd 復(fù)位信號(hào)復(fù)用腳: 當(dāng) 8951 通電,時(shí)鐘電路開始工作,在 RESET 引腳上出現(xiàn) 24 個(gè)小 時(shí)鐘周期以上的高電平,系統(tǒng)即初始復(fù)位。初始化后,程序計(jì)數(shù)器 PC 指向 0000H, p0p3 輸出口全部為高電平,堆棧指針寫入 0BH,其它專用寄存器被清零。 RESET 由高電平下降為底電平后,系統(tǒng)即從 0000H 地址開始執(zhí)行程序。然而,初復(fù)位步改變 RAM(包括工作寄存器 R0R7)的狀態(tài), 8951 的初始態(tài)。 8951 的復(fù)位方式可以是自動(dòng)復(fù)位,也可以是手動(dòng)復(fù)位,此外 RESET/Vpd 還是一復(fù)用腳, Vcc 掉電期間,此腳可接上備用電源,以保證單片機(jī)內(nèi)部 RAM 的數(shù)據(jù)步丟失。 . Pin30: ALE/PROG 引腳: 當(dāng)訪問外部程序時(shí) , ALE(地址鎖存)的輸出用于鎖存地址的低字節(jié)位。而訪問內(nèi)部程序存儲(chǔ)器時(shí), ALE 端將由一個(gè) 1/6 的時(shí)鐘頻率的正脈沖信號(hào),這個(gè)脈沖信號(hào)可以用于識(shí)別單片機(jī)是否工作,也可以當(dāng)作一個(gè)時(shí)鐘向外輸出。更由一個(gè)特點(diǎn),當(dāng)訪問外部程序存儲(chǔ)器, ALE 會(huì)跳過也個(gè)脈沖。如果單片機(jī)時(shí) EPROM,在編程期間, PROG 將用于輸入編程脈沖。 電 子 時(shí) 鐘 的 設(shè) 計(jì) 與 制 作 6 . Pin31: EA/Vpp 引腳: 程序存儲(chǔ)器的內(nèi)外部選通線, 8051 和 8751 單片機(jī),內(nèi)置由 4kB 時(shí),讀取內(nèi)部程序存儲(chǔ)器指令數(shù)據(jù),而超過 4kB 地址則讀取外部指令數(shù)據(jù)。如 EA 為低電平,則部管地址大小,一律 讀取外部程序存儲(chǔ)器指令。顯然,對(duì)內(nèi)部無程序存儲(chǔ)器的 8031,EA 端必須接地。在編程時(shí), EA/Vpp 腳還需加上 21V 的編程電壓。它體積小,成本低,功能強(qiáng),廣泛應(yīng)用于智能產(chǎn)品和工業(yè)自動(dòng)化上。而 51 單片機(jī)時(shí)個(gè)單片機(jī)中最為典型和最由代表的一種。這次畢業(yè)設(shè)計(jì)通過對(duì)它的學(xué)習(xí),應(yīng)用,從而達(dá)到學(xué)習(xí)、設(shè)計(jì)、開發(fā)軟硬的能力。 電 子 時(shí) 鐘 的 設(shè) 計(jì) 與 制 作 7 2 驅(qū)動(dòng)器 74LS245 簡介: 1. 74LS245 是我我們常用的芯片,用來驅(qū)動(dòng) LED 或者其它的設(shè)備,它是 8 路同相三態(tài)雙向總線收發(fā)器,可雙向傳輸數(shù)據(jù)。 2. 當(dāng) AT89S51 單片 機(jī)的 P0 口總線負(fù)載達(dá)到或超過 P0 最大負(fù)載能力時(shí),必須接入74LS245 等總線驅(qū)動(dòng)器。 3. 當(dāng)片選端低電平有效時(shí), DIR=0,信號(hào)由 B 向 A 傳輸:(接收) .DIR=1,信號(hào)由向 B 傳輸:(發(fā)送)當(dāng)片為高電平時(shí), A、 B 均為高阻態(tài)。 4. 由于 P2 口始終輸出地址的高 8 位,接口時(shí) 74LS245 的三態(tài)控制端 /1G 和 /2G 接地,P2 口與驅(qū)動(dòng)器輸入線對(duì)應(yīng)相連。 P0 口與 74LS245 輸入端相連 /E 端接地,保證數(shù)據(jù)暢通。 89S51 的 RD 和 PSEN 相與后接 DIR,使得 RD 或 PSEN 有效時(shí), 74LS245輸入 DI 到 ,其它時(shí)間處于輸出 到 DI。 圖三 電 子 時(shí) 鐘 的 設(shè) 計(jì) 與 制 作 8 3 LED 數(shù)碼管簡介 LED 數(shù)碼管顯示器結(jié)構(gòu)與原理 單片機(jī)中通常用七段 LED 構(gòu)成字型 “8”,另外,還有一個(gè)小數(shù)點(diǎn)發(fā)光二極管以顯示小數(shù)位!這種顯示器有共陰和共陽兩種!發(fā)光二極管的陽極連在一起的(公共端)稱為共陽極顯示器,陰極連在一起的稱為共陰極顯示器。 一位顯示器由 8 個(gè)發(fā)光二極管組成,其中, 7 個(gè)發(fā)光二極管構(gòu)成字型 “8”的各個(gè)筆劃(段) a g,另一個(gè)小數(shù)點(diǎn)為 dp 發(fā)光二極管。當(dāng)在某段發(fā)光二極管上施加一定的正向電壓時(shí),該段筆畫即亮;不加電壓則暗。為了保護(hù)各段 LED 不被損壞,需外 加限流電阻。 共陰極 7 段 LED 顯示數(shù)字 0 ~ F、文字、符號(hào)及小數(shù)點(diǎn)的編碼( a 段為最地位,dp 點(diǎn)為最高位) 共陰極 7 段 LED 顯示字型編碼表 顯示字符 共陰極段選碼 顯示字符 共陰極段選碼 0 3FH 5 6DH 1 06H 6 7DH 2 5BH 7 07H 3 4FH 8 7FH 4 66H 9 6FH 滅 00H 表一 LED 顯示器接口及顯示方式 LED 顯示器有靜態(tài)顯示方式和動(dòng)態(tài)顯示方式兩種。靜態(tài)顯 示就是當(dāng)顯示器顯示某個(gè)字符時(shí),相應(yīng)的段恒定的導(dǎo)通或截止,直到顯示另一個(gè)字符為止。 LED 顯示器工作于靜態(tài)顯示方式時(shí),各位的共陰極接地;若為共陽極則接 +5V 電源。每位的段選線分別與一個(gè) 8 位鎖存器的輸出口相連,顯示器中的各位相互獨(dú)立,而且各位的顯示字符一經(jīng)確定,相應(yīng)鎖存的輸出將維持不變。正因?yàn)槿绱?,靜態(tài)顯 電 子 時(shí) 鐘 的 設(shè) 計(jì) 與 制 作 9 示器的亮度較高。這種顯示方式編程容易,管理也較簡單,但占用 I/O 口線資源較多。因此,在顯示位數(shù)較多的情況下,一般都采用動(dòng)態(tài)顯示方式。 由于所有 8 位段皆由一個(gè) I/O 口控制,因此,在每一瞬間, 8 位 LED 會(huì)顯示相 同的 字符。要想每位顯示不同的字符,就必須采用掃描方法流點(diǎn)亮各位 LED,即在每一瞬間只使某一位顯示字符。在此瞬間,段選控制 I/O 口輸出相應(yīng)字符段選碼(字型碼),而位選則控制 I/O 口在該顯示位送入選通電平(因?yàn)?LED 為共陰,故應(yīng)送低電平),以保證該位顯示相應(yīng)字符。如此輪流,使每位分時(shí)顯示該位應(yīng)顯示字符。在多位 LED 顯示時(shí),為了簡化電路,降低成本,將所有位的段選線并聯(lián)在一起,由一個(gè) 8 位 I/O 口控制。而共陰(共陽)極公共端分別由相應(yīng)的 I/O口線控制,實(shí)現(xiàn)各位的分時(shí)選通。段選碼,位選碼每送入一次后延時(shí) 1MS,因人的視覺暫 留時(shí)間為 ( 100MS),所以每位顯示的時(shí)間不能超過 20MS,并保持延時(shí)一段時(shí)間,以造成視覺暫留效果,給人看上去每個(gè)數(shù)碼管總在亮。這種方式稱為軟件掃描方式。 圖四 上面這個(gè)只是七段數(shù)碼管引腳圖,其中共陽極數(shù)碼管引腳圖和共陰極的是一樣的。 . 數(shù)碼管使用條件: 1. 段及小數(shù)點(diǎn)上加限流電阻 2. 使用電壓:段:根據(jù)發(fā) 光顏色決定; 小數(shù)點(diǎn):根據(jù)發(fā)光顏色決定 電 子 時(shí) 鐘 的 設(shè) 計(jì) 與 制 作 10 3. 使用電流:靜態(tài):總電流 80mA(每段 10mA);動(dòng)態(tài):平均電流 45mA 峰值電流 100mA。 . 數(shù)碼管使用注意事項(xiàng): 1. 數(shù)碼管表面不要用手觸摸,不要用手去弄引角 2. 焊接溫度: 260 度;焊接時(shí)間: 5S 3. 表面有保護(hù)膜的產(chǎn)品 ,可以在使用前撕下來。
點(diǎn)擊復(fù)制文檔內(nèi)容
規(guī)章制度相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1